WebInsulin is injected into the fatty tissue below the skin. Your thighs, upper arms, buttocks and stomach are the best places to make insulin injections, but this should be discussed with your Diabetes Healthcare Team. Rotating your injection site is important because if the fat beneath the skin gets hard or lumpy it can affect the way your body ... WebApr 1, 2024 · In Japan, skin disinfection is typically considered necessary before an insulin injection to prevent infection at the injection site. This cross-sectional study evaluated factors that influenced symptoms of injection site infection among 238 Japanese patients who self-injected insulin for diabetes between October 2015 and January 2016. These insulins are ideal for preventing blood sugar spikes … WebRecommended insulin regimens. Patients with type 1 diabetes should be offered multiple daily injection basal-bolus insulin regimens as the first-line choice.Twice-daily insulin detemir should be offered as the long-acting basal insulin therapy, unless the patient is already meeting their agreed treatment goals on another insulin regimen.
